David Sean Taylor wrote:


David (Le Strat),

The new Role Management portlet does not run on Tomcat 4.1.30 here Not sure why, I just get a blank portlet under View Roles, new errors I debugged the portlet and it does correctly populate the list of roles

However it is running fine on 5.0.28

Going to try it on 5.5.4 now...


On first try, not much luck with 5.5.4 Can't get J2 to connect to the database

[org.apache.ojb.broker.accesslayer.ConnectionFactoryAbstractImpl] ERROR: SQLExce
ption thrown while trying to get Connection from Datasource (java:comp/env/jdbc/
jetspeed)
Cannot create JDBC driver of class '' for connect URL 'null'
org.apache.tomcat.dbcp.dbcp.SQLNestedException: Cannot create JDBC driver of cla
ss '' for connect URL 'null'
at org.apache.tomcat.dbcp.dbcp.BasicDataSource.createDataSource(BasicDat
aSource.java:780)
at org.apache.tomcat.dbcp.dbcp.BasicDataSource.getConnection(BasicDataSo
urce.java:540)


I put the jetspeed.xml into the same place as with 5.0.x
And i added my jdbc driver into endorsed directory

Anyone had any luck running on 5.5.4?
